BREAKING: The White House just issued a statement supporting the decision to release The Interview in theaters: “The president applauds Sony’s decision to authorize screenings of the film. As the president made clear, we’re a country that believes in free speech and the right of artistic expression. The decision made by Sony and participating theaters allows people to make their own choices about the film and we welcome that outcome.”
During his annual year-end news conference last week, President Obama said Sony “made a mistake” in opting to pull the Seth Rogen-James Franco comedy from theatrical release following threats from cyberterrorists. Sony Pictures quickly responded to the White House rebuke, saying it “had no choice” but to scrap the release.
